Top Key Companies for Digital Oil Nozzle Market: Chintan Engineers, Piusi, STM, Kamal Industries, Alemlube, GRACO, Permex, KOEO, YongJia Aocheng Hardware co., ltd..
Global Digital Oil Nozzle Market Size was estimated at USD 285.35 million in 2022 and is projected to reach USD 591.88 million by 2028, exhibiting a CAGR of 12.93% during the forecast period.
